    Overview of Authentication
    This section is an overview of the Authentication feature used with the machine. 
    Users Controlled by Authentication
    The following is an explanation about the different user types that are controlled by the 
    Authentication feature.
    Users are classified into the following four types. The Authentication feature restricts 
    operations according to the user type.
    • Key Operators
    • Entered Users
    • Unentered Users
    • General Users
    Key Operators
    These are users who can enter and change system settings.
    A Key Operator uses a special user ID called a Key Operator ID.
    To enter the Key Operator mode, enter the Key Operator ID into the user ID entry field 
    on the authentication screen.
    Entered Users
    These are users who are registered with the machine.
    When an Entered User uses a service that is restricted, the user must enter their user 
    ID on the authentication screen.

    Unentered Users
    These are users who are not registered with the machine.
    An Unentered User cannot use services that are restricted.
    General Users
    These are general users who are not permitted to use the machine in the authenticated 
    mode.
    Types of Authentication
    Two types of authentication are used by the machine depending on where user 
    information is stored.
    Direct Authentication
    Direct Authentication uses the user information stored in the machine to manage 
    authentication.
    Network Authentication
    Network Authentication uses the user information from a remote account server to 
    manage authentication.
    User information on a remote account server is sent to, and stored in the machine. 
    When the user information on the server is changed, that information must be sent from 
    the server to update the machine.
    This authentication method is used to simplify the management of user information on 
    multiple machines.
    Functions Controlled by Authentication
    The following explains the functions that are restricted by the Authentication feature.
    Restriction depends on which of the following two ways the machine is used.
    • Local Access
    • Remote Access
    For more information on the restrictions to mailboxes and job flow sheets using the 
    Authentication feature, refer to Authentication for Job Flow Sheet and Mailbox on 
    page 288.
    Local Access
    Direct operation of the machine from the control panel is called Local Access.
    The functions restricted by Local Access are as follows.
    Copy
    The copy function is restricted. When the function uses job memory, that job memory 
    is also restricted.
    Downloaded From ManualsPrinter.com Manuals 
    						
    							Overview of Authentication 
    Xerox CopyCentre/WorkCentre/WorkCentre Pro 123/128/133 User Guide 287
    Fax/Internet Fax
    The fax and Internet Fax functions are restricted. When either of these functions use 
    job memory, that job memory is also restricted.
    Scan
    The Scan to Mailbox, Network Scanning and Scan to FTP/SMB functions are restricted. 
    When any of these functions uses job memory, that job memory is also restricted.
    Mailbox
    If the Authentication feature is enabled, authentication is required for mailbox 
    operations even if you are not using the Authentication and Auditron Administration 
    features for copying, faxing, scanning, and printing.
    Job Flow Sheets
    If the Authentication feature is enabled, authentication is required to execute job flow 
    sheets even if you are not using the Authentication and Auditron Administration 
    features for copying, faxing, scanning, and printing.
    Print
    The printing of documents that have been saved to the machine is restricted for the 
    Charge Print feature.
    Remote Access
    Operation of the machine through a network using CentreWare Internet Services is 
    called Remote Access.
    The functions restricted by Remote Access are as follows.
    Print
    Printing is limited to print jobs sent from a computer.
    To use the Authentication feature, use the print driver to set authentication information 
    such as user ID and password. 
    The print jobs sent to the machine that fail authentication are set to Charge Print and 
    are either saved to the machine or deleted, depending on the selected setup option.
    Direct Fax
    Direct Fax from a computer is restricted.
    To use the Authentication feature, use the fax driver to set authentication information 
    such as user ID and password. 
    The fax jobs sent to the machine that fail authentication are set to Charge Print and are 
    either saved to the machine or deleted, depending on the selected setup option.

    CentreWare Internet Services
    If the Authentication feature is enabled, authentication is required to access the 
    CentreWare Internet Services home page even if you are not using the Authentication 
    and Auditron Administration features for copying, faxing, scanning, or printing.
    Authentication for Job Flow Sheet and Mailbox
    The following explains the restrictions for job flow sheets and mailboxes when the 
    Authentication feature is enabled.
    NOTE: When a user account is deleted, the mailboxes and job flow sheets associated 
    with the account are also deleted. Any documents stored in the mailboxes will also be 
    deleted.
    NOTE: When the Authentication and Auditron Administration features are used with a 
    remote account server, the user information stored in the machine may be temporarily 
    deleted to restrict user access. When this happens, the mailboxes and job flow sheets 
    associated with the user will also be deleted. When using a remote account server to 
    manage authentication, use of mailboxes and job flow sheets in the Key Operator 
    mode is recommended.
    Job Flow Sheet Types
    There are four types of job flow sheets that can be used with the machine.
    NOTE: You can create Mailbox Job Flow Sheets with the machine.
    Generally Shared Job Flow Sheet
    This job flow sheet is created by a General User without using the Authentication 
    feature.
    When the Authentication feature is not enabled, this job flow sheet is shared and its 
    settings may be changed by any user.
    When the Authentication feature is enabled, this job flow sheet can only be operated 
    by a Key Operator.
    Mailbox Job Flow Sheet
    This job flow sheet is created by a General User or a Key Operator using [Mailbox] on 
    the [Setup Menu] screen.
    The owner of this job flow sheet is set to the mailbox it was created from. Any user who 
    has access to the mailbox can use and change its settings.
    This job flow sheet can only be operated when the Authentication feature is not 
    enabled. When the Authentication feature is enabled, only a Key Operator can operate 
    this job flow sheet.
    Downloaded From ManualsPrinter.com Manuals 
    						
    							Authentication for Job Flow Sheet and Mailbox 
    Xerox CopyCentre/WorkCentre/WorkCentre Pro 123/128/133 User Guide 289
    Key Operator Shared Job Flow Sheet
    This job flow sheet is created by a Key Operator.
    When the Authentication feature is not enabled, this job flow sheet is shared and its 
    settings may be changed by any user.
    When the Authentication feature is enabled, the parent job flow sheet can be shared 
    by all Entered Users. However, only a Key Operator can change its settings.
    To create a Key Operator Shared Job Flow Sheet, operate the machine as a Key 
    Operator.
    Personal Job Flow Sheet
    This job flow sheet is created by an Entered User when the Authentication feature is 
    enabled.
    Only the Entered User who created the job flow sheet can use it.
    This job flow sheet can only be operated by a Key Operator when the Authentication 
    feature is not enabled.
